Engineering Technician - Machinist

Beyond New Horizons, LLC (BNH) is seeking a Machinist to support TOS II at Tunnel 9 in White Oak, Maryland. The Machinist will operate and maintain equipment in a small machine shop, handling minor repair and fabrication jobs while collaborating with engineers and technicians on design feasibility and precision component assembly.

Responsibilities

Perform independently with minimal supervision non-repetitive assignments of a complex and difficult nature involving the set-up and operation of a wide variety of manual machine tool equipment such as CNC and manual milling machines, presses, lathes, surface grinder, band saws, and other machine shop equipment
Work from prints, rough sketches, production diagrams, engineering drawings, and verbal instructions to fabricate a variety of simple and complex machined components
Work with engineers and other technicians on the design feasibility of machine parts and assemblies relative to form, fit and function
Determines operating methods and sequences; lay out, set up and fabricate precision parts, tooling and fixtures to exacting tolerances and dimensions for short-run or single unit components
Make complex shop calculations to layout difficult patterns and determine tooling feeds and speeds
Understands the working qualities of a wide variety of materials including aluminum, steel, copper, brass, plastics, and exotics
Measure height, depth, diameter, and thickness using micrometers, dial indicators, calipers, gauges and other precision-measuring instruments
Inspects work for conformance to specifications
Ability to identify and specify tooling and equipment to be purchased
Maintains a clean, neat, and organized workspace
Ability to make estimates and manage schedules and throughput
Performs standardized or prescribed assignments involving a sequence of related operations
Follows standard work methods on recurring assignments but receives explicit instructions on unfamiliar assignments
Communicate effectively and frequently with the engineering staff, team leader, and other technicians
Able to work with other machinists
Has a working knowledge of safe working techniques and procedures
It is a condition of employment to wear PPE (Personal Protective Equipment) in accordance with supervisory direction and company policy
Perform other duties as required
